Post-doctoral Research Position – Simulating the carbon dynamics and greenhouse 
gas exchanges from whole ecosystem ‘best practices’ restoration
A post-doctoral research position is available in the Department of Geography, 
McGill University (Montreal, Canada).  The research is attempting to adapt 
existing peatland ecosystem carbon models (McGill Wetland Model or 
wetland-DNDC) to simulate the changes in carbon dynamics that occur with the 
extraction of peat from pristine peatlands and various restoration strategies.  
This research is being done in a collaborative project that is examining the 
changes in vegetation community structure, hydrology and the ecosystem – 
atmosphere exchanges of CO2 and CH4.  It is anticipated because of the physical 
changes to the peat profile that an energy – water balance model will have to 
be developed to replace the current land surface package that we coupled to 
MWM.  There will also have to be modifications to the vegetation and 
biogeochemistry components of MWM.
